自修復材料市场的成长和趋势

根据 Grand View Research, Inc. 的新报告,全球自修復材料市场预计到 2033 年将达到 146 亿美元,2025 年至 2033 年的复合年增长率为 21.1%。

中东和亚太地区的新兴经济体正在经历显着的工业和经济发展以及人口的成长,这导致建筑支出激增,预计这将在预测期内推动这些地区对自修復材料的需求。

自修復材料是建筑材料领域的最新趋势,因为它们能够在受损或暴露于环境条件后进行自我修復。这些材料旨在增强涂料、复合材料、混凝土和沥青的耐久性和保存性。

此外,自修復材料在有机电子装置的发展中也发挥重要作用,其终端应用包括新型整合和行动装置。随着可拉伸、可印刷和便携式电子产品的发展,自修復场效电晶体(OFET) 在市场上的重要性日益凸显。因此,随着可再生能源需求的不断增长以及有机电子领域的快速发展,预计未来几年自修復材料的发展也将进一步扩大。

然而,这些材料的高成本限制了市场的成长。自修復材料,例如聚合物、金属、陶瓷及其复合材料,在使用过程中受损后能够完全或部分恢復其原始性能。由于生产过程中涉及昂贵的工艺流程,这些材料比传统材料更昂贵。此外,将自修復材料进一步加工成最终产品的成本也很高。

主要的自修復技术分为自生修復、化学添加剂修復和生物基修復。自生修復是指材料自动修復裂缝的能力。化学添加剂修復依赖一系列化学反应。这些反应主要由两种修復剂——胶囊和血管——组成,它们分解时会释放出化学剂,自动修復裂缝。第三种是生物基修復,占大多数,它涉及添加细菌来诱导碳酸钙,并形成密封层,防止裂缝中水的渗透。

自修復材料市场的特点是其价值链两个阶段的整合:很少有製造商参与原材料的生产,也很少有製造商将这些原材料用于自修復材料的生产。这种策略使企业能够规范其原材料的质量,确保产品的最高品质。这也有助于企业减轻价格波动和供应链中断的影响。

Self-healing Materials Market Growth & Trends:

The global self-healing materials market size is expected to reach USD 14.60 billion by 2033, registering a CAGR of 21.1% from 2025 to 2033, according to a new report by Grand View Research, Inc. The surged construction spending in the emerging economies of the Middle East and Asia Pacific, owing to substantial industrial and economic development in them, coupled with their population expansion, is anticipated to fuel the demand for self-healing materials in these regions over the forecast period.

Self-healing materials are a recent development in the field of building and construction materials, as they are capable of repairing themselves following damage or exposure to environmental conditions. These materials are designed to enhance the durability and shelf life of coatings, composite materials, concrete, and asphalt.

Additionally, self-healing materials are significant in development of organic electronics, with several end-use applications, including new integrated and portable devices. With the development of stretchable, printable, and implantable electronics, self-healing organic field-effect transistors (OFETs) are gaining increasing importance in the market. Hence, with increasing demand for renewable energy and rapid development in the field of organic electronics, market demand for self-healing materials is also expected to grow in the coming years.

However, high cost of these materials acts as a restraint in the growth of a market. Self-healing materials such as polymers, metals, ceramics, and their composites can fully or partially restore their original properties after being damaged during operational use. These materials are costlier than conventional materials owing to the expensive technological processes involved in their manufacturing. Moreover, the further processing of self-healing materials into final products is also expensive.

Major self-healing technologies are divided into autogenous healing, chemical additives-based healing, and bio-based healing. Autogenous healing is concerned with the ability of a material to repair cracks automatically. Chemical additive-based healing depends upon a series of chemical reactions. Reaction mainly consists of two healing agents, namely capsules and vascular tubes, which, when broken down, release chemical agent that repairs cracks automatically. Third, most technology bio-based healing involves the incorporation of bacteria, which induces calcium carbonate and builds up the seal against crack-related water ingress.

Self-healing materials market is characterized by integration across the two stages of value chain. Few of the manufacturers are involved in the production of raw materials as well as well as captively consume these materials for the production of self-healing materials. This strategy aids companies in regulating the quality of raw materials that ensures premium quality products. It also helps in mitigating the effects of price volatility and any disruption in supply chain.
